Troubleshooting

Knob is loose after installation.

Ensure the screw is fully tightened. If the screw is too short for your cabinet thickness, you may need to purchase a longer screw of the same thread size.

Screw does not fit the existing hole.

These knobs use standard screw sizes. If your existing hardware used a different size, you may need to purchase compatible screws or slightly enlarge the hole if comfortable with DIY.

Matte black finish appears smudged.

Gently wipe the surface with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that can damage the finish.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Remove Existing Hardware: Unscrew the old knobs or pulls from your cabinets or drawers.
  2. Prepare Surface: Ensure the mounting hole is clear of debris.
  3. Install New Knob: Insert the provided screw from the inside of the cabinet or drawer. Align the knob with the screw and hand-tighten.
  4. Secure Knob: Use a screwdriver to fully tighten the screw, ensuring the knob is firmly attached but do not overtighten.

Compatibility:

These knobs are designed to fit standard cabinet and drawer thicknesses. The included screws are typically designed for common applications. If your furniture has a significantly thicker door or drawer front, you may need to source longer screws separately.

Care:

To maintain the appearance of the matte black finish:

  • Wipe clean with a soft, damp cloth.
  •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ads, as these can scratch the finish.
  • For stubborn marks, use a mild soap solution and wipe dry with a clean cloth.
